Almost 700 Guests Visited Architect Knud Friis' Own House at Højen in Brabrand

Summary by Vores Brabrand
Almost 700 guests visited the heritage building at Højen 13 in Brabrand on Sunday and explored the house that Aarhus architect Knud Friis designed more than 70 years ago for himself and his family. The house is now owned by Realdania By & Byg, which invited everyone interested inside on Sunday.
